Ealing Broadway station is adeptly equipped to handle the daily throng of passengers, offering a range of facilities to enhance the commuter experience. The station boasts ticket offices open from early morning until late at night, ensuring you can purchase and collect your rail tickets with ease. For those who prefer the convenience of technology, ticket machines are accessible and intuitive, even for individuals with any mobility or sensory needs. The station is designed with inclusivity in mind, reflected in its step-free access and staff assistance throughout.
Customer service is a priority at Ealing Broadway. A dedicated help point and proactive ticket office staff ensure you have all the guidance you need. Concerns about luggage? While there's no baggage storage, the ever-watchful CCTV secures your peace of mind as you journey through. Toilets and baby changing facilities are easily accessible on the concourse, making it a family-friendly stop for travelers of all ages.
Beyond the tracks, Ealing Broadway provides seamless connectivity to multiple forms of transportation. You can easily hop on a Transport for London bus right outside the station or slide into the tunnels of the London Underground via the Central and District Lines. For those jetting off to further destinations, the Elizabeth Line offers a direct route to Heathrow Airport, simplifying your travel plans.
Want to explore the city on two wheels? Bicycle hire services such as Brompton Dock are conveniently available, ensuring that you enjoy your journey sustainably. Although there are no bicycle storage spaces or sheltered parking at the station, cycling enthusiasts will find ample ways to navigate the cityscape.

Limehouse Station boasts a range of facilities designed to ensure passenger convenience. Ticketing options are versatile, with a ticket office open during peak hours, complemented by easy-to-use ticket machines available throughout the day. For those who prefer collecting tickets bought online, machines provide this service for seamless travel preparation. Accessibility is thoughtfully addressed, with step-free access throughout the station and dedicated lifts to platform 2 for southbound travelers.
While the station might lack some amenities like waiting rooms and refreshment facilities, the commitment to passenger safety is ensured with CCTV surveillance. Wi-Fi access further adds to the connectivity convenience for travelers navigating their journeys. As you plan, note that though there's no on-site luggage storage, shops cater to your immediate needs, ensuring you’re stocked up on essentials before embarking.
Limehouse Station connects seamlessly with the Docklands Light Railway, providing a hassle-free option for reaching central London hotspots or travelling to London City Airport. For road-bound adventures, a host of bus routes service the area ensuring smooth connectivity across London. If you're looking to pedal your way through London’s scenic routes, bicycle hire services like Santander Cycles are nearby, ready with numerous docking stations.
When it comes to rail journeys, Limehouse is a springboard into exciting destinations. Frequent routes include convenient trips to bustling Barking, peaceful Leigh-On-Sea, and the dynamic London Fenchurch Street. For a full day out, the ride to Chafford Hundred Lakeside offers access to Lakeside Shopping Centre's retail delights.
This versatile station opens up travel possibilities to West Ham, Grays, and even coastal escapes like Westcliff, bringing the best of city and countryside within reach.
